VMOU Diploma Courses List
The following is the list of Vardhman Mahaveer Open University (VMOU) diploma courses. Students can choose a program according to their interests, career goals, and academic qualifications. The VMOU diploma courses list includes the following programmes:
- Diploma in Computer Accounting and Management
- Diploma in Culture and Tourism
- Diploma in Library and Information Science
- Diploma in Mass Communication
- Diploma in Watershed Management
- Diploma in Yoga Science
VMOU Diploma Courses Eligibility Requirements
To apply for VMOU diploma courses Admission, students need to meet the following eligibility requirements:
- Diploma in Computer Accounting and Management: Candidates must have passed the Senior Secondary (10+2) examination or an equivalent qualification from a recognised board. Candidates who passed the Higher Secondary examination from the Board of Secondary Education, Rajasthan, Ajmer, by 1989 are also eligible. Alternatively, candidates who have passed the Secondary (10th) examination and possess at least two years of relevant work experience in a Chartered Accountant firm, accounting organisation, IT firm, computer office, or a similar establishment may also be considered eligible for admission.
- Diploma in Culture and Tourism, Library and Information Science, Mass Communication, and Yoga Science: Candidates must have passed the 10+2 examination or an equivalent qualification from a recognised board. Alternatively, candidates who have completed BAP, BScP, or BCP from any open university are also eligible. Candidates who passed the Higher Secondary examination from the Board of Secondary Education, Rajasthan, Ajmer, by 1989, or have completed the CCT programme from Vardhman Mahaveer Open University (VMOU), are also eligible for admission.
VMOU Diploma Courses List and Fees
The VMOU diploma courses fee structure is designed to be affordable and accessible to students from different backgrounds. Students can pay their course fees online from anywhere using Internet Banking, Debit Card, Mobile Banking, or an e-Mitra Kiosk. Before enrolling in a diploma programme, students should check the course-wise fee details to understand the total cost of their chosen programme. The following table provides the VMOU diploma courses list and fees:
| VMOU Diploma Course List | VMOU Diploma Courses Fees (Total) |
|---|---|
| Diploma in Computer Accounting and Management | 4900 |
| Diploma in Culture and Tourism | 4300 |
| Diploma in Library and Information Science | 4500 |
| Diploma in Mass Communication | 5200 |
| Diploma in Watershed Management | 3300 |
| Diploma in Yoga Science | 6400 |

Is Vardhman Mahaveer Open University (VMOU) recognised by the government?
Yes, Vardhman Mahaveer Open University (VMOU) was established under an Act passed by the Government of Rajasthan in 1987. The university is recognised by the UGC, DEB, and NCTE and is also a member of AIU.
When does the admission process for VMOU diploma courses begin?
The admission process for VMOU diploma courses generally begins twice a year, in January and July.

Is there any age limit for admission to VMOU Diploma courses?
No, VMOU Diploma courses do not have an upper age limit; students, working professionals, and retired individuals can apply or continue their higher studies.

What is the duration of VMOU Diploma courses?
The VMOU Diploma courses have a minimum duration of 12 months and a maximum duration of 24 months.
